WILSON, N.C.--No. 9 seed Coker College (19-30) defeated No. 4 seed Barton College (27-28), 7-4, in an elimination game of the 2008 Conference Carolinas Baseball Tournament on Friday morning at Barton's Nixon Field. Coker later lost a 3-2 decision to Erskine to end its season in historic Fleming Stadium.

The Bulldogs jumped out to a 1-0 lead in the first inning on a single by Zach Boyette and a double by Michael Parker. However, the Bulldogs went in order over the next five innings against Coker starter Justin Collier (2-1). By the time Barton finally got on the board again, it was 7-2 in the ninth.

With one out, relief pitcher Sam Pepper ripped a solo homer to right. Travis Holloman followed with a single and scored on Allen Corbett's double. A strikeout and flyout ended the Bulldogs' season, and the careers of seniors Justin Bye, Quinn Fuller, Brent Godwin, Chris Hill, John Miller, Michael Parker, Jeremy Tucker and Travis Holloman.

Both teams finished with nine hits. Barton made three errors and Coker committed three. Coker counted one run in the first on singles by Trey Lynch and Julio Gomez and a throwing error. Barton went up 2-1 in the second when Jonathan Nichols was hit by a pitch, stole second and scored on a throwing error.

The Cobras took a 3-2 lead in the second on a walk, a single by B.K. Harfst and a two-run double by Preston Ford. The lead grew to 4-2 in the fifth on three walks and a throwing error. Coker added two runs in the sixth on a triple by Ford, a walk, a sacrifice bunt and a two-run double by Gomez. The Cobras plated their final run in the seventh. Poole was hit by a pitch, went to second on a groundout, to third on a Ricky Deleandro single and home when a pickoff attempt at third by the catcher went awry. No player had more than one hit for the Bulldogs while Gomez was 3-for-4 and Ford 2-for-4 for the Cobras. Both players had 2RBI.

Barton freshman left-handed starter Matt Watson (3-2) suffered the loss in 4 1/3 innings of action while Coker's Mikael Owens earned his sixth save.
